OPPO Reno4 Pro
256 GB, Galactic Blue, 6.50", Dual SIM, 48 Mpx, 5GProduct details
The OPPO Reno4 Pro features a top-notch 6.5-inch 3D curved AMOLED screen. With a refresh rate of 90 Hz, it provides an even more enjoyable tactile experience and good handling. The smartphone is practical for both on-the-go and home use, as it is remarkably lightweight and thin. At just 7.6 mm thick, this 5G smartphone weighs a mere 172 grams. The triple-camera system of the OPPO Reno4 Pro includes a 48 MP HD main camera, a 12 MP ultra-wide-angle lens, and a 13 MP telephoto lens. Thanks to the Ultra Night Video feature, high-quality video recordings can be made regardless of lighting conditions. The OPPO Reno4 Pro is equipped with OPPO's 65W SuperVOOC 2.0 fast charging technology, which allows the battery to charge from zero to one hundred percent in just 36 minutes. The OPPO Reno4 Pro supports 5G and features a dual SIM slot. It comes with 12 GB of RAM and 256 GB of ROM, and is available in Space Black and Galactic Blue colors.
